My audio files date back from current to whatever version of Audacity and/or Windows existed during and since Jan, 2008.  All are MP3 encoded and saved at a 128 Kbps constant bitrate as LOR recommends.  Never had an issue with any audio (beyond a corrupt MP3 file once) with any Windows or LOR S2/S3 version.

 

I needed no other drivers for LOR to run in either Windows 8 or 8.1.  I did load the USB485 drivers from LOR so I was sure I could run the show from the 8.1 laptop if it became necessary, but I have no idea if they were needed - I just did it out of habit.

The new PC with Windows 7, or 8 will need to have the drivers loaded for your USB Adapter. Make sure that you go to the LOR firmware update site and get the version 2.08.30 and install these. You will need to run the installer before you connect a USB Adapter. You only have to do this once on the newer laptop, or desktop. There is also a help sheet on USB problems that you can download from LOR to walk you thru the screens. Once you have the driver installed, you still need to open up your devices window and associate the driver to the PC. Until you see the COM port listed by the adapter in the devices your not done. This is a good time of year to check all your software versions on your LOR controllers, Light Linkers, anything and make sure they are the most up to date. All the downloads are on the www1.lightorama.com/firmware-updates/ page. If you are running E1.31 or DMX you may have some additional work to do.
